> Log:
> Teach ScalarEvolution to sharpen range information.
>
> If x is known to have the range [a, b) in a loop predicated by (icmp
> ne x, a), its range can be sharpened to [a + 1, b).  Get
> ScalarEvolution and hence IndVars to exploit this fact.
>
> This change triggers an optimization to widen-loop-comp.ll, so it had
> to be edited to get it to pass.

> +  if (FoundPred == ICmpInst::ICMP_NE) {
> +    // If we are predicated on something with range [a, b) known not
> +    // equal to a, the range can be sharpened to [a + 1, b).  Use this
> +    // fact.
> +    auto CheckRange = [this, Pred, LHS, RHS](const SCEV *C, const SCEV
> *V) {
> +      if (!isa<SCEVConstant>(C)) return false;
> +
> +      ConstantInt *CI = cast<SCEVConstant>(C)->getValue();
> +      APInt Min = ICmpInst::isSigned(Pred) ?
> +        getSignedRange(V).getSignedMin() :
> getUnsignedRange(V).getUnsignedMin();
> +
> +      if (Min!= CI->getValue()) return false; // nothing to sharpen
> +      Min++;
> +
> +      // We know V >= Min, in the same signedness as in Pred.  We can
> +      // use this to simplify slt and ult.  If the range had a single
> +      // value, Min, we now know that FoundValue can never be true;
> +      // and any answer is a correct answer.
> +
> +      switch (Pred) {
> +        case ICmpInst::ICMP_SGT:
> +        case ICmpInst::ICMP_UGT:
> +          return isImpliedCondOperands(Pred, LHS, RHS, V,
> getConstant(Min));
> +
> +        default:
> +          llvm_unreachable("don't call with predicates other than
> ICMP_SGT "
> +                           "and ICMP_UGT");
> +      }
> +    };
> +
> +    if ((Pred == ICmpInst::ICMP_SGT) || (Pred == ICmpInst::ICMP_UGT)) {
> +      // Inequality is reflexive -- check both the combinations.
> +      if (CheckRange(FoundLHS, FoundRHS) || CheckRange(FoundRHS,
> FoundLHS)) {
> +        return true;
> +      }
> +    }
> +  }
> +
